触发器原理是什么?

悬赏分:20|

其 他 回 答共1条

1楼

SQL SERVER如下
触发器分为for 触发器和instead of 触发器
两种原理大不一样
for 触发器等于是
执行完用户的数据操纵命令后,继续执行触发器的代码
instead of 触发器是
使用触发器代码,替换用户的数据操纵
触发器的还提供两个表为触发器内置表,为代码提供操纵数据的依据
inserted和deleted
新数据表和旧数据表
当用户插入数据,inserted表里有用户插入的新数据,deleted 表没有数据
因为插入数据,是没有旧数据的
当用户更新数据,inserted表里有用户更新后的新数据,deleted表里有更新前的旧数据
当用户删除数据,deleted表里有用户删除的数据,inserted表里没有数据
因为删除数据是没有新数据的
知识库标签: 触发器   |列兵

我来回答这个问题

立即登陆回答获取会员积分,提高用户级别
友情链接:
Copyright © 商名网 All Rights Reserved.